If there is ANY pattern or print that can instantly be labeled as “trashy”, it is animal print. However, its a different story when that zebra print dress has a little “LV” sewn into the label.
Mister Jacobs and his crew at Louis Vuitton shocked the audience at his Spring 2011 into a fashion coma when he sent his models strutting down the runway in bold colors, flashy sequins and LOTS of animal print.
The collection was thoroughly inspired by the Orient, and a few of the extremely asian looks in the beginning of the show miss the mark. They come off looking more like fancy halloween costumes than high-end couture.
That being said, if any designer can pull of animal print with elegance and class, its Marc Jacobs.
